Regular Season Round 36: BHY Tiro Federal - Union SF 67-75
Date: February 11, 2016
Rather predictable result when second ranked Union SF (16-12) won against 6th ranked BHY Tiro Federal (9-19) in Morteros 75-67 on Thursday. The guests trailed by 1 point at the halftime before their 25-12 charge in the third quarter, which allowed them to win the game. Union SF shot the lights out from three sinking 15 long-distance shots on high 55.6 percentage. It was a good game for American power forward Jonathan Durley (203-88, college: Wichita St.) who led his team to a victory with 17 points and 6 rebounds. Naturalized Italian Juan Kelly (190-88) contributed with 14 points for the winners. Point guard Tomas Acosta (180-91) replied with a double-double by scoring 17 points and 13 rebounds and power forward Pablo Rizzo (201-84) added 16 points in the effort for BHY Tiro Federal. Union SF maintains second position with 16-12 record having just three point less than leader Platense. Loser BHY Tiro Federal keeps the sixth place with 19 games lost. Union SF will face league's leader Villa Angela in Villa Angela in the next round and it will be for sure the game of the week.
